Ok, so hopefully this will be the last update of this thread. FedEx just dropped off the new 124g ammo. Upon initial visual inspection, it seems as if they got it right this time.Whoever they got as their new manufacture looks like they did a good job. They are packed loosely 50 to a box(no tray), and the first two I measured were both .354.5. They used Aguila brass and the bullets just look like a nicer bullet as well. Only thing different I noticed is I'm guessing that line on the brass is a crimp marking? Never was that on any other ammo I've shot. Not sure if I'm gonna keep them or sell them yet.
